Definitions

(noun) foot; leg
(adjective) sufficient; enough; ample

Etymology

Pictograph of a foot () attached to a leg.

About

The character "足" is structured with "口" positioned above "止" in its standard form, and its core meaning has always been "foot". From this concrete reference, it developed the abstract sense of "sufficient" or "enough", a semantic extension likely originating from the concept of having feet as a basis for completeness or stability. This dual meaning emerged early in the character's history, with both applications enduring in written Chinese.
